Yes, the peppermint (or clove) oil does NOT go directly on breast or nipple,
but may be put on a swab and wafted close to the baby's nose so that the
scent makes them more alert.  This is from Kelly Taubert, an OT in Wyoming.
Sounds like something to try before more extreme measures are used.
